a month-to-month lease is a type of periodic tenancy a periodic tenancy automatically renews at the end of each period until one of the parties decides to terminate the agreement by giving proper notice of termination generally in a month-to-month lease if the tenant or landlord wishes to terminate the lease he or she must give at least 30 days of notice of termination for the termination to be valid state and local laws govern landlord tenant rules so a tenant or landlord should consult their local laws to be clear about the time restraints on terminating month-to-month leases either party can terminate the lease agreement with proper notice
